If Transcriptor logs the emote "Saphiron erhebt sich in die Lüfte!", does BigWigs also need this exact emote in the translation or is "%s erhebt sich in die Lüfte!" enough?
Because the airphase_trigger didn't work for me today, but if BigWigs should work with either the Name or %s there must be a different bug.
Btw: For the deepbreath_trigger Transcriptor logs it with %s: "%s holt tief Luft." It's just for the airphase_trigger where the name is logged instead of %s.
If Transcriptor logs the emote "Saphiron erhebt sich in die Lüfte!", does BigWigs also need this exact emote in the translation or is "%s erhebt sich in die Lüfte!" enough?
No, because we need to match the event trigger. Didn't believe it and put in a %s, but it makes sense to me now. It's just not consistent with enUS.
